' Irelantis'
is the theme and collective title of a body of paper collages first made by Irish artist Seán Hillen between 1994 and '98.
Since 2005
Seán has made some new Irelantis works.

Using a scalpel and glue and sometimes a microscope, Seán mixed fragments of postcards and other 'found materials' in elaborate compositions to create a fantastic but seemingly possible Other place, where The Pyramids nestle in Carlingford Lough, John Hinde's freckled-faced children collect meteorites outside the Observatory at Knowth, and Newry Gagarin, the celebrated cosmonaut, hovers over the Dublin streets.

Seán Hillen:

Seán Hillen was born in 1961 in Newry, County Down, Northern Ireland, and studied at the Belfast College of Art, the London College of Printing and the Slade School, London. He now lives and works in Dublin.

In 1998 Irelantis Ltd. was formed by Seán Hillen and lawyer Linda Scales to protect and develop the intellectual property in 'IRELANTIS'. They were joined in 1999 by stage director Miriam Duffy and designer / artist Clare O'Hagan. The company then published a book, designed by Clare, of the Irelantis collages.
